  4. 12 gru 2022 · sin(− θ) = − sinθ sin (− θ) = − sin θ. cos(− θ) = cosθ cos (− θ) = cos θ. cot(− θ) = − cotθ cot (− θ) = − cot θ. csc(− θ) = − cscθ csc (− θ) = − csc θ. sec(− θ) = secθ sec (− θ) = sec θ. The Reciprocal Identities define reciprocals of the trigonometric functions. sinθ = 1 cscθ sin θ = 1 csc θ.
